Transaction 84657746991ecb58b7fbc58aee280d9948d7a10f103a4fbd82c159dbc9bbc39e

1 Input
2 Outputs
  • 84657746991ecb58b7fbc58aee280d9948d7a10f103a4fbd82c159dbc9bbc39e:0
  • value  231595
    address  33kKokFYe5AZydybDd1ojJYM8rSLxDHpsE
  • 84657746991ecb58b7fbc58aee280d9948d7a10f103a4fbd82c159dbc9bbc39e:1
  • value  2205462
    address  1Do99xfATNWvxynH5Dgy1bxw32pWwfbqbJ